**Mgmt Meeting Minutes — Retiring the Brightline Range**

Quick recap for sales leads at Fenholt Supplies: we agreed to retire the Brightline fixture range by year-end. Remaining stock moves to clearance pricing next month, and accounts on standing orders get migrated to the Lumetta range. Trade-in incentives were approved in principle. The confidential note on next steps sits just below.

board note of bajof-bajeg: The pricing group signed off on a budget of $13.4 million for Project Sildor. The renewal with Lamixek Holdings closes at $48.9 million a year, 49 percent above the last contract.

**Q: Does the Tallyhorn sidecar transmit raw metric payloads off-host?**

No. Tallyhorn aggregates counters locally and ships only rolled-up summaries over mutual TLS to the collector tier. Raw samples never leave the pod, and labels are scrubbed against an allowlist before export. The full data-flow diagram and threat model are maintained on the page below.

wiki page, tahaf-tajog: https://jira.ordindyn.corp/pipeline

Dedup pipeline overview for review. Meridell customer records are matched nightly by the Tallyfox job using fuzzy name plus normalized postal fields. Matches above 0.92 confidence merge automatically; the rest queue for manual review in Sortbench. Watch the merge ordering in dedup_core.rs — survivorship rules pick the oldest record as canonical. The job calls the internal identity service for final writes, authenticated per run. The service key for the staging run sits directly below.

gateway credential: kto3_qfe

PortionPal runs three environments: dev, sandbox, and prod. Plugin authors get sandbox access only. Sandbox resets nightly; do not store test recipes there long-term. Rate limits in sandbox are lower than prod — design accordingly. Scaling math is identical across environments, but rounding rules and unit tables can differ by version, so always check the sandbox build banner before filing bugs. Each environment advertises its settings through the info endpoint, and the current sandbox values are reproduced below.

deployment values, taduf-fawig:
WENAEL_HOST=wenael.zemvarlabs.internal
WENAEL_PORT=8443